Chapter 4 System BIOS
BIOS Operation
Chapters 3 through 8 of this manual describe the operation of the American Megatrends AMIBIOS and the
BIOS Setup Utility. Refer to
Running AMIBIOS Setup
later in this chapter for standard Setup screens,
options and defaults. The available Setup screens, options and defaults may vary if you have a custom
BIOS.
When the system is powered on, AMIBIOS performs the Power-On Self Test (POST) routines. These
routines are divided into two phases:
1)
System Test and Initialization
. Test and initialize system boards for normal operations.
2)
System Configuration Verification
. Compare defined configuration with hardware actually
installed.
If an error is encountered during the diagnostic tests, the error is reported in one of two different ways. If
the error occurs before the display device is initialized, a series of beeps is transmitted. If the error occurs
after the display device is initialized, the error message is displayed on the screen. See
BIOS Errors
later in
this section for more information on error handling.
The following are some of the Power-On Self Tests (POSTs) which are performed when the system is
powered on:
CMOS Checksum Calculation
Keyboard Controller Test
CMOS Shutdown Register Test
8254 Timer Test
Memory Refresh Test
Display Memory Read/Write Test
Display Type Verification
Entering Protected Mode
Memory Size Calculation
Conventional and Extended Memory Test
DMA Controller Tests
Keyboard Test
System Configuration Verification and Setup
AMIBIOS checks system memory and reports it on both the initial AMIBIOS screen and the AMIBIOS
System Configuration screen which appears after POST is completed. AMIBIOS attempts to initialize the
peripheral devices and if it detects a fault, the screen displays the error condition(s) which has/have been
detected. If no errors are detected, AMIBIOS attempts to load the system from a bootable device, such as a
hard disk. Boot order may be specified by the
Boot Device Priority
option on the Boot Setup Menu as
described in the
Boot Setup
chapter later in this manual.
